It looks like fans will have to wait a bit longer before they can see her and do uncomfortable and unpleasant things to each other in the “Do What U Want (With My Body)” video. The debut of the song’s much-anticipated music video has been delayed, and the Queen Monster is not shy about placing the blame on others.

“It is late because, just like with the Applause video unfortunately, I was given a week to plan and execute it,” Gaga said in the very dramatic post. “Those who have betrayed me gravely mismanaged my time and health and left me on my own to damage control any problems that ensued as a result. Millions of dollars are not enough for some people. They want billions. Then they need trillions. I was not enough for some people.”

Ah, the struggles of the misunderstood artist. At least it wasn’t delayed because R. Kelly found himself trapped in a closet again.

While there currently isn’t a release date for the video, Gaga’s fans — in true “little monster” form — are not only accepting her apology, but they are reaffirming her status as a deity in their lives.

One fan posted below Gaga’s apology, “Gaga you ARE our Goddess, we don’t have nothing to forgive, we are here for u and for all u need. We adore u, we adore ARTPOP, and we adore all of U. We can wait all the time for the video so don’t worry, you are the most important.” Amen…
